- [ ] Confirm webhook retry semantics for the Hollyvane delivery service: exponential backoff capped at six attempts, idempotency keys honored across retries, and dead-letter routing enabled. Plugin authors relying on at-least-once delivery must verify their handlers deduplicate correctly before this ships. Run the replay harness against the staging endpoint and record the outcome. The verified release build is identified below.

session token of tajef-bageg = htk21_5d90d574934f3ccae6437

**Ticket: Config drift on BounceSift processor**

The email bounce processor in the Larkfield environment has drifted from the values committed in the release branch. Retry windows and suppression thresholds no longer match, which likely explains the duplicate suppression entries reported Tuesday. Please reconcile before the Thursday cut. For reference, the currently deployed configuration on the live node reads as follows.

config for yajep-yahof:
[briax]
port = 9200
region = outer-2
host = briax.nelvrocorp.test
team = raleth
timeout_ms = 1500
retries = 1

The Faregrid pricing-experiment API assigns each ticket lookup to a variant bucket. Call POST /experiments/{id}/assign with the session hash; the response includes bucket, price multiplier, and expiry. Assignments are sticky for 72 hours. Do not cache multipliers client-side. All experiment endpoints require authentication; for sandbox calls, use the bearer token below.

session JWT of yawep-yawep = eyJhbGciOiJIUzI1NiIsInR5cCI6IkpXVCJ9.eyJzdWIiOiI3pWF3_In0.aXYsHiog